Coffee Shop Simulator

Go-based application designed to model the workflow of a coffee shop. It scales with the number of orders and gracefully handles errors and resource constraints.

Features

Concurrent Order Processing

  • Baristas: A configurable number of baristas process orders in parallel.
  • Grinders and Brewers: Multiple grinders and brewers with configurable grinding and brewing rates. Baristas access grinders and brewers concurrently via resource pools (i.e., a Go channel for each resource type to manage available grinders and brewers).
  • Orders: Supports orders with different sizes (Small, Medium, Large—with each being mapped to specific fluid ounces) and strengths.
  • Order Management: A Go channel that's used to queue customer orders to be processed by Baristas.
  • Beans: Starts with a set amount of coffee beans, with each order consuming beans based on the size and strength of the coffee.
  • Completion Tracking: Wait-groups (newOrdersWG, completedOrdersWG) and channels (*CoffeeShop.done) are used to keep track of the completion status of orders and help prevent deadlocks. Failure is a valid completion state—this happens after an order fails to complete following maxRetries attempts.

Real-time Interaction

  • Refill Command: It's possible to refill coffee beans in real-time by simply entering a refill command in the running shell. This updates the total number of beans in the coffee shop (available to all goroutines) in a thread-safe manner using a mutex.

Error Handling and Retries

  • Exponential Backoff: Orders that can't be processed immediately due to unavailable resources are retried with an exponential backoff strategy. This is used in order to handle errors gracefully.
